MPX – High Performance LDPE Shrink Bundler Film
Heavy-duty shrink packaging, as a widespread industrial application LDPE. Shrink film made from ldpe shrinks closely around shelved products when treated with warm air in an automated shrink tunnel, or manually through heat guns and infrared envelope appliances, creating a complete rigid, thereby compact, stable unit. Industrial buyers work with leading ldpe shrink film suppliers to obtain continuous rolls for semi-automated and fully automated wrapping lines. These are generally used for the packing of drink bottles, canned foods, ceramic tile(s), pharmaceutical carton, chemical container and automotive parts. The tare of LDPE shrink wrapping is much lower than that of heavy corrugated cardboard boxes, which ultimately leads to lighter freight, reduced fuel consumption and packaging cost. Moreover, shrink-wrapped multi-packs are tamper-evident because any puncture or tear in the applied plastic film is visibly and immediately detected at delivery. In film extrusion, control of the longitudinal and transverse shrinkage ratios is important for preventing distorted packs or loose wrapping when running at high speed.
Heavy-Duty Pallet Wrapping and Unitization
Palletization remains critical in modern logistics and warehouse movement, mustering palletized loads against shifting, vibration and toppling during movement. Heavy-gauge stretch wraps and giant shrink hoods that cover entire pallet loads of stacked cartons, bagged cement, fertilizer sacks or industrial drums are formed from LDPE and LLDPE films Shrink hooding refers to the tracking of taking a gusseted LDPE bag and shrinks it around the loaded pallet with heat, resulting in a five-sided (weather-tight) protective cover that stabilizes the load and allows for open-air outdoor yard storage. LLDPE (linear low-density polyethylene) enhanced film has puncture resistance preventing sharp pallet corners and protruding nails from propagating tears across the wrap. Correctly unitized pallets minimize transport damages, avoid cargo theft and simplify fork-lift handling in logistic hubs as well as maritime shipping terminals.

Construction, Agriculture, and Industrial Liners
Heavy-duty low-density polyethene( LDPE) film has important applications, not only in consumer goods packaging but also in construction, agriculture and chemical processing. In construction, thick LDPE sheets (typically 100 to 250+ µm) used as crucial damp-proof membranes (DPMs), vapor barriers under concrete slab foundations and temporary protective weather covers for exposed machines and raw building materials. LDPE and LLDPE scaffolds are used as very thin UV-stabilized (>90%) greenhouse covers, silage wraps, and soil mulch films that can increase temperature while maintaining moisture in addition to weed suppression in modern agriculture. Widespread use of heavy-duty LDPE tubular liners in corrugated bulk boxes, steel drums and flexible intermediate bulk containers (FIBC jumbo bags) to prevent fine powder leakage or chemical corrosion of the outer container is a common practice at industrial chemical and mineral plants. Circular Economy, Recycling and Material Complements
The industrial packaging sector is transitioning to addressing concerns of plastic waste by way of downgauging, design-for-recycling and post-consumer recycled (PCR) resin integration as environmental regulations and the circularity goals set across corporations gain momentum. Since LDPE is a homopolymerize thermoplastic material, it may be easily recycled into secondary industrial plastic film (basically re-granulated purged industrial scrap) and garbage bags and construction sheets obtained from sorted post-use recycling. Moreover, sophisticated polymer blend and multilayer blown film extrusion enable manufacturers to down-gauge film thickness by 15%-25% without losing tensile strength or tear resistance directly saving raw material use and carbon footprint. Certified mono-material LDPE shrink films can then be easily sorted at a recycling facility and mechanically reprocessed, unlike multi-material laminated foils which present recycling challenges. Industrial packaging that is sustainable, accomplishes a balance between resource conservation and yet no compromise in containment of the load.
